Audi Q7 Depreciation Rate and Curve
Are you researching the depreciation rates in a Audi Q7? On this page, we'll list all the depreciation information for the 13 years of data we have for the Audi Q7 - from 2007 to the most recent model in 2020.
Audi Q7 Historical Depreciation Table
Below is a historical table for the Audi Q7 that displays year by year depreciation data.
Model Year |
Price When New |
(%) Current Depreciation |
($) Current Depreciation |
Current Residual Value |
2020 |
$58,400 |
20% |
$11,760 |
$46,640 |
2019 |
$58,128 |
39% |
$22,916 |
$35,212 |
2018 |
$53,800 |
40% |
$21,660 |
$32,140 |
2017 |
$52,250 |
32% |
$16,750 |
$35,500 |
2015 |
$51,360 |
54% |
$27,665 |
$23,695 |
2014 |
$50,820 |
60% |
$30,465 |
$20,355 |
2013 |
$50,267 |
67% |
$33,459 |
$16,808 |
2012 |
$49,717 |
73% |
$36,459 |
$13,258 |
2011 |
$49,717 |
76% |
$37,950 |
$11,767 |
2010 |
$48,900 |
77% |
$37,688 |
$11,212 |
2009 |
$48,900 |
82% |
$40,081 |
$8,819 |
2008 |
$48,350 |
85% |
$41,275 |
$7,075 |
2007 |
$47,900 |
87% |
$41,512 |
$6,388 |
